README.md

agent-orchestrator rewrite docs

The agent-orchestrator is being rebuilt as a long-running Go backend daemon
(backend/) plus an Electron + TypeScript frontend (frontend/). The backend
supervises coding-agent sessions and exposes daemon control, project/session
state, terminal streaming, and CDC/event infrastructure.

Start with architecture.md for the current backend model and
cli/README.md for the CLI surface.

Mental model

Persist durable facts, derive display status:

  • session table: activity_state, is_terminated, identity, metadata
  • PR tables: PR/CI/review facts
  • derived read model: service.Session computes display status from session + PR facts
